answersLogoWhite

0


Best Answer

The ship was moored in Turks and Caicos on July 9, 2009 at the Nikki Beach Marina. Boat owner was supposedly Paul Allen from Microsoft, but can't be verified.

The yacht is owned by the Morse family who started "The Villages" in Florida.

User Avatar

Wiki User

13y ago
This answer is:
User Avatar

Add your answer:

Earn +20 pts
Q: Who owns the yacht cracker bay?
Write your answer...
Submit
Still have questions?
magnify glass
imp